♦ People vs. Campuhan
o mere touching of the private organ of the victim should be
understood as inherently part of the entry of the penis into the labias
of the female organ and not mere touching alone of the mons pubis
or pudendum
o Thus, touching when applied to rape cases does not simply mean
mere epidermal contact, stroking or grazing of organs, a slight brush
or a scrape of the penis on the external layer of the victim's vagina,
or the mons pubis
o There must be sufficient and convincing proof that the penis indeed
touched the labias or slid into the female organ and not merely
stroked the external surface thereof for an accused to be convicted of
consummated rape. As the labias are required to be "touched" by the
penis, which are by their natural situs or location beneath the mons
pubis or the vaginal surface, to touch with the penis is to attain some

One for Acts of Lasciviousness: Aug 29 Balbar with deliberate intent to
satisfy his lust, willfully, unlawfully and feloniously commit an act of lasciviousness on
the person of Ester, a public school teacher, by placing himself close to her,
embracing and kissing her against her will and by means of force. And as a result,
the Ester fell to the floor, causing her injury, resulting to pain and tenderness on the
right side of the trunk on the posterior surface of the right arm which may require 3-
4 days to heal. Committed with the aggravating circumstance of perpetrated inside
the public school bldg during class hours.
 The accused filed a motion to quash arguing that the Direct Assault charge had no
sufficient cause of action and that it charges two offenses in a single complaint. And
secondly, that the charge of acts of Lasciviousness would place the accused in Double
Jeopardy.
 So even if the Prov. Fiscal disagrees, the lower court quashed the two informations
saying that the Lasciviousness is absorbed in the physical injuries or unjust vexation
(it can’t be direct assault because the element of direct assault is absent in the info).
Since the physical injuries or unjust vexation within the original jurisdiction of the
justice of Peace then the information is quashed(along with the absorbed).
 Then the Government appealed that the main element of direct assault is missing in
the info, which is the knowledge of the accused that the person is in authority. 1

Issue
WON the Lower court made an error in quashing the information for the said
reasons above.YES
 There is no need for the allegation in the info of the knowledge of the accused of the
authority of the teacher.
 She is a teacher inside her classroom during school hours in the performance of her
duty makes the fact known to the accused.
 It doesn’t matter if it wasn’t alleged. Complainant’s status is a matter of law and not
of fact, ignorance of this is no excuse. (art.3 cc)

WON the dismissal of the information for lack of lasciviousness is correct. YES
 The SC agrees with this conclusion, that although some acts lead to more than one
offense, upon examination of the events, it seems that the acts of lasciviousness
does not appear to have been committed.
